IOutputCachePolicy Schnittstelle

Definition

Eine Implementierung dieser Schnittstelle kann aktualisieren, wie die aktuelle Anforderung zwischengespeichert wird.

public interface IOutputCachePolicy
type IOutputCachePolicy = interface
Public Interface IOutputCachePolicy

Methoden

CacheRequestAsync(OutputCacheContext, CancellationToken)

Aktualisiert die OutputCacheContext, bevor die Cache-Middleware aufgerufen wird. An diesem Punkt kann die Cache-Middleware für die Anforderung weiterhin aktiviert oder deaktiviert werden.

ServeFromCacheAsync(OutputCacheContext, CancellationToken)

Aktualisiert die OutputCacheContext, bevor die zwischengespeicherte Antwort verwendet wird. An diesem Punkt kann die Aktualität der zwischengespeicherten Antwort aktualisiert werden.

ServeResponseAsync(OutputCacheContext, CancellationToken)

Aktualisiert die OutputCacheContext, bevor die Antwort bereitgestellt wird und zwischengespeichert werden kann. Zu diesem Zeitpunkt kann die Zwischenspeicherbarkeit der Antwort aktualisiert werden.

Gilt für: